改良动态前路稳定术及盂唇成形术治疗伴有SLAP损伤的前肩不稳

Modified Dynamic Anterior Stabilization and Labroplasty for Anterior Shoulder Instability With Concomitant SLAP Lesion.

Abstract

Several arthroscopic techniques to treat anterior shoulder instability have been described. Bankart repair may be insufficient in cases with some degree of bone loss, and arthroscopic Latarjet is technically challenging. It is not rare to find at the time of surgery a more extensive labral tear (SLAP lesion) or an insufficient anterior capsulolabral tissue. We describe for those cases a dynamic anterior stabilization where using the long head of the biceps we are treating the SLAP lesion and at the same time it provides the "sling effect" of a Latarjet procedure for the anterior instability.

摘要

已经描述了几种治疗肩关节前不稳定的关节镜技术。对于存在一定程度骨质流失的病例,Bankart修复可能并不充分,并且关节镜下Latarjet手术在技术上具有挑战性。在手术时发现更广泛的盂唇撕裂(SLAP损伤)或前关节囊盂唇组织不足的情况并不少见。对于这些病例,我们描述了一种动态前路稳定术,即利用肱二头肌长头治疗SLAP损伤,同时它为前路不稳定提供了Latarjet手术的“吊带效应”。
